Thomas Eric Kuckhoff ’14, MBA ’21 Receives 2022 Roaring10 Award

Thomas Kuckhoff of Huntington Station, New York, graduated from Clemson in 2014 with a b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ering and earned a Clemson Master of Business Administration degree in 2021.

A licensed engineer in the State of South Carolina, Thomas started his career with ABB Motors and Mechanical Inc. in Greenville. He recently joined Omron Automation and currently leads its industrial controller business for the Americas. While at ABB, he pioneered the design and performance of innovative products that resulted in 13 U.S. patents and 17 ABB engineering achievement awards.

Thomas championed ABB’s participation in Clemson’s Mechanical Engineering Capstone Program, which works with industry partners to give undergraduate students real-world design and problem-solving experience. He also significantly grew ABB’s engagement with Clemson’s Cooperative Education Program, through which undergraduates get on-the-job work experience.

Thomas has been a leader in multiple community service roles, including board member, committee chair and volunteer. He focuses on education for a wide breadth of students through non-profits such as Junior Achievement of the Upstate and the Center for Developmental Services.

Supporting United Way of Greenville County as a Hands on Greenville team leader and a Loaned Executive, Thomas furthered his community impact as an alumnus of PropelGVL and Leadership Greenville. Both are joint leadership programs between the United Way and the Greenville Chamber of Commerce. Driven by his non-profit experience he led the establishment of the Dodge Industrial Foundation in Greenville as a source of scholarships for local students. He was named to Greenville Business Magazine’s Best and Brightest 35 and Under list in the fall of 2022.
